Why Death Was The Perfect Villain In Puss In Boots: The Last Wish
Death’s Personal Connection With The Protagonist Made Him Extremely Menacing
Death wasn’t the only villain inPuss in Boots: The Last Wish, but he left the biggest impression for a variety of reasons.Alongside his fantastic design and menacing personality, Death was perfectly used throughout the film, constantly lurking in the background and biding his time when it came to the protagonist.
Although Puss has taken on numerous antagonists without fear, the fact he was down to his last life made Death so daunting.
The protagonist had never worried about mortality before, but with dying becoming a real possibility, Death’s presence made the movie so much more thrilling.

Shrek Movies
Budget
Box Office
Shrek(2001)
$60 million
$492 million
Shrek 2(2004)
$150 million
$932 million
Shrek the Third(2007)
$160 million
$813 million
Shrek Forever After(2010)
$165 million
$756 million
Puss in Boots(2011)
$130 million
$555 million
Puss in Boots: The Last Wish(2022)
$90 million
$485 million
